Abstract
-cross Abstract: Sparse matrix computation performance on GPU depends on how representation and execution schedule match the input structure and target hardware. No single implementation consistently dominates across sparsity patterns, operators, and hardwares. Existing sparse compilers and specialized systems cannot cover all of them simultaneously. We present SparseDitto, an agentic sparse compilation framework for sparse matrix computation on GPUs. It jointly synthesizes representation, execution schedule, and hardware mapping in a unified compilation plan. Structural analysis and a learned template-ranking prior guide architecture-aware synthesis. LLM-guided lowering realizes each plan as CUDA code, while target-GPU profiling drives plan refinement. SparseDitto covers multiple operators, e.g., SpMV, SpMM, and SpGEMM, and various representations within one framework. It can also automatically adapt to different hardwares. Across various SuiteSparse matrices, SparseDitto achieves geometric-mean speedups over cuSPARSE of $2.68\times$ on an NVIDIA RTX PRO 6000 and $2.79\times$ on an NVIDIA H200 (up to 146.61$\times$). Its generated SpMM kernels accelerate full-batch GCN training by up to $3.39\times$.
